West vs Swift: Kanye IS Hip-Hop
I’m having a chuckle reading the various online pundits *gasp* with shock as they report on Kanye’s latest outburst at a televised awards program. The comments can be best summarized this way: poor victim Taylor Swift gets blindsided by pompous autotune rapper having a temper tantrum on stage.
Besides the fact that I don’t give a hot damn about Ms. Swift, or the fact that it could have very well all been staged by the good folks at MTV, I actually appreciate Kanye even more after watching the goings on last night. Let me explain it thusly: right now, at this moment, Kanye West IS hip-hop. Or at least he embodies the spirit of hip-hop.
Back before most of you remember (so, more than 5 years ago), rap music wasn’t about fitting in or being nice. It was about fighting against the system; about being a Rebel Without A Pause, about being Tougher Than Leather. Back then, you wore your anti-establishment ethos with pride. Raised fist. Arms folded. Hat down. Not giving a f–k. Hip. Hop.
Sure, artists (and even fans) all wanted to gain popular and corporate acceptance, because that meant hip-hop wouldn’t have to struggle anymore. We wouldn’t have to go down to the underground record spot to pick up the latest (limited) release from our favorite artist. But there was a description for that back in the day: selling out.
You say hip-hop has lost its way? It has no heart? A shell of its former angry, principled self? Then you, my friend, should be standing up and applauding Kanye for living life as an artist on his own terms and not giving a sweet damn. Being unafraid to walk out on stage surrounded by corporate music suits and lay into them. Repeatedly. Kanye got on the mic and spoke truth to power.
He was a true rap MC last night, in the mold of KRS-One or Rakim. Sure, the forum and subject matter matter may have made him look more like ODB than Chuck D, but few have the guts and/or the balls to do what Kanye did.
Last night, Kanye was hip-hop.
